bennymundz Posted May 17, 2015 Share Posted May 17, 2015 I am somewhat of a novice when it comes to this virtualisation stuff so please i apologize in advance. Under unraid beta15 and below i had a bunch of ubuntu vm's running my various apps. (I know docker can do this but its not what i want) so in Xen i set these up as PV virtual machines. Everything was running well till rc2 was released with no Xen support. Thats fine, i've upgraded and now are tring to get my ubuntu vm's back. When i go through the vm guest setup page i select the old image and launch. Everything appears fine it loads grub then this is where it fails. The screen just goes to blank and does nothing. I've tried changing the cpu mode, the machine type with no avail. Are my pv ubuntu virtual machines i created under Xen dead or am i doing something wrong. Any feedback would be appreciated. Woodpusherghd Posted May 17, 2015 Share Posted May 17, 2015 Paravirtualized ubuntu images will not work in KVM which requires hardware virtualization. In theory you could manipulate the Linux kernel but I gave up trying and just re-installed my ubuntu server in KVM using the VM manager. Link to comment
